A man has been rushed to hospital following a suspected road rage stabbing involving a motorbike in Rainham in the early hours of Tuesday morning.

Police and ambulance crews were called at around 3:41am to reports of an assault at the junction of New Road and Cherry Tree Lane.

A spokesperson for the London Ambulance Service confirmed:

“We were called at 3.41am today (25 June) to reports of an assault at the junction of New Road and Cherry Tree Lane, Rainham.

We sent an ambulance crew to the scene and treated a patient before taking them to hospital.”

The incident led to the closure of New Road while emergency services responded. The road has since reopened as of approximately 9:50am, but police remain at the scene to investigate the circumstances.

UKNIP  understands the victim was stabbed following a confrontation linked to a motorbike, and that the incident may be road-rage related. However, full details from the Metropolitan Police have not yet been released.

A spokesperson for the Met said further updates will follow once initial enquiries are complete.

Residents reported seeing a large police presence and road cordons in place throughout the early morning.
